For two hours to-day scenes of rioting took place at Berlin University. Hitlerist students kept shouting through loud speakers “Perish Judea” “Out with the Jews!”. Several Jewish students were beaten.
The Rector of the University refused to allow police to enter the University to put down the rioting, invoking the principle of University autonomy.
